- 1、本文档共4页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
低成本高精度小型智能测温仪设计与实现(热敏电阻).pdf
第30卷 第5期 大 连 交 通 大 学 学 报 Vo1.30 No.5
2009年 10月 J0URNAL OF DALIAN JIA0T0NG UNIVERSITY Oct.2009
文章编号:1673-9590(2009)05—0019—04
低成本高精度小型智能测温仪设计与实现
王道顺 ,徐天娇
(大连交通大学 机械工程学院,辽宁 大连 116028)
摘 要 :基于模块化设计思想,采用Atmegal6单片机,实现了高精度测量、高可靠性、低功耗的小型智能测
温仪的设计.该系统运用软件编程的方法,将Atmegal6单片机 自带的10位A/D转换器分辨精度提高到了
11位,使系统的输出显示精度提高了一倍.该系统能方便的与计算机终端相连,从而能建立大型的温度监
测系统.
关键词:测温仪 ;模块化思想;Atmegal6单片机 ;高精度显示
中图分类号:TP212.6 文献标识码:A
U 5I吾
嵌入式设计 已经成为工业现代化、智能化的
必经之路,对嵌入式产品人们提出了模块化软件
设计的模型.模块化设计的核心是模块的独立性,
主要包括功能独立性和结构独立性,这使得软件
开发的分工易于实现.本仪表的设计就是采用
AVR高速嵌入式芯片Atmegal6,应用模块化设计
思想,达到了功能独立性和结构独立性的设计.
1 系统硬件设计 图1 硬件组成框 图 ’
1.1 微处理器模块
该系统用Atmega16单片机,能使用4种不同 此小型测温仪采用 AVR单片机 中的At。
的温度传感器 (PT100,CuS0,4—20mA,80—900Q) megal6芯片,它是一款高性能、低功耗、非易失性
采集温度作为输入信号,实现了温度采集、门限限 存储器的微控制器,具有以下特点:
定、超标报警、通讯等功能.数据采集前端通过运 (1)可擦写 1000次的Flash程序存储器、可
放接 口芯片组成的差分输入电路,用Atmegal6单 擦写 100000次的EEPROM;
片机 自带的 10位ADC转换实现高精度 的AD转 (2)高速度和低功耗,具有休眠功能;
换;通过对数码管驱动可对测量结果、设置过 (3)高度必威体育官网网址性;
程 中的参数进行直观显示;另外 ,Atmegal6的 (4)工业级产品;
EEPROM用于存储设置与校准参数,并设置 了看 (5)工作电压范围宽 1.8~6.0V,电源抗干
门狗定时器,使系统更加可靠. 扰能力较强 ;
小型智能测温仪的硬件结构主要 由微处理器 (6)超功能精简指令.
模块、传感器模块、键盘模块、数码显示模块、通讯 1.2 电源模块
模块以及电源模块组成.其硬件组成框图如图1 仪表通过变压器,桥式整流滤波电路,稳压电
所示. 路获得处理器所需要的电源.本设计充分考虑了
收稿 日期 :2009—03.07
作者简介:王道顺(1959一),男,教授,学士,主要从事仪器仪表与传感器智能化技术的研究
E-mail:dlwds@ 163.com.
大 连 交 通 大 学 学 报 第30卷
能源的有效性,所以采用 Atmega16芯片,它提供 1.3 传感器模块
了6种休眠模式,进入休眠模式后可以使应用程 传感器模块电路如图2
文档评论(0)